Cooperative learning is more than grouping children together it is helping students learn to work together toward a common learning goal with each person doing their part in the project. Just as in a jigsaw puzzle, each pieceeach students partis essential for the completion and full understanding of the final product. Cooperative learning is a studentcentered, instructorfacilitated instructional strategy in which a small group of students is responsible for its own learning and the learning of all group members.
